Ceiling Brace
If the tray becomes a bit
loose, or if you need to
change the angle of the
legs, you can do so with
the tray support.
Loosen the adjustment
bolt shown in Fig. 5, move
the tray support in the
appropriate direction as
shown by the arrows, and
then retighten the bolt.
If you use the bending
grooves, etc., and the vice
starts to lift up, you can
stabilise and x it in place
by placing a pipe of
sucient length between
the ceiling brace and a
rm roof beam.

①Use only in a stable location
・Make sure the feet are in a stable position which allows the vice to keep its balance.
・If it overturns, it could result in an injury.
②Check for damage
・Before use, make sure there is no damage to any of the working parts and that the vise can fully operate in a   
normal way and perform all its prescribed functions correctly.
③Be careful not to get your ngers, etc. caught when setting up the tool tray
・When setting up the tool tray, folding up the stand to carry it, or when putting it away for storage, be careful not to  get
your ngers caught in the tray.
④Make sure you use the leg chain to x the legs in position when carrying
the Stand
・Never forget to use the leg chain!
・Using excessive force on the leg chain could break the links resulting in injury or an accident.
⑤Ensure the workpiece is securely xed in position before starting work
・If the chain is loose, the pipe could fall o, which could lead to a very dangerous situation.
⑥ Be careful the stand will not fall over.
・Should it be necessary to apply considerable force to the vice stand, be sure to remove the rubber
grommets and x the stand in position with an anchor or similar.
・If the stand falls over it could lead to injury or an accident.
⑦Store carefully when not in use
・Store in a dry, locked room, out of the reach of children.
⑧Always ask a specialist to carry out any repairs or an overhaul
・REX products are designed to comply with high standards of safety. Never try to dismantle or repair them yourself.
・For any repairs, always contact the place where you purchased the product, or your nearest REX sales oce.

When you set up the
stand, open the legs
and push the tool tray
down until it locks into
position.
When you have
nished using the
stand, turn it upside
down and push down
on the tray to return it
to its closed position.
Whenever you carry the
stand, x the legs in
position with the leg
chain so that the legs
don't suddenly open
up.
Be careful not to pinch your ngers when pushing down
the tool tray as you set up. Also, keep your face away from
the tray in case it suddenly snaps back.
Be careful not to apply too much force when you put the
stand away or the legs may suddenly close up and you
could possibly injure yourself or hit yourself in the face.
Do not use excessive force on the leg chain or else it could
break. Walk evenly when carrying the stand
